Best car I've ever owned!

I own a 2011 EX V6. I bought it with 61,000 miles on it in March 2021. I have just at 111,000 miles on it now. Best car I've ever owned. Had a mustang and Camaro before this and they were terrible. The worst problem I've had is the driver side door won't open from the outside, but opens from the inside. The battery died about 2 months after I bought, but I bought a new one, and it's been fine since. The driver side headlight went out bout a month ago but replaced it. Driver side fog light is out. Had check engine light come on about a month ago, but it was just the gas cap. Honestly, I've seen a lot of people with bad 2011 sorentos, so I'm grateful mine is good. Older couple in their 80s bought it brand new in 2010, and then I bought it at the dealership as they were finalizing their new Buick purchase. They told me the history of the car and everything. They barely drove the car 6,000 miles a year, so I think I lucked out. Now, the car feels every bump on the road, so not the comfiest SUV I've been in. The leg room isn't terrible in the 2nd row, but good luck with a rear facing car seat lol. You'll have to move the driver or passenger seat forward if you put the car seat behind them.

Sorento tranny not so 'bullet proof' after all.

My 2011 KIA Sorento was purchased new from the dealer in Atlanta during the Summer of 2010 (2.4L LX). There have been some minor problems during the years since, but lately, I have been hearing some whining noises coming from the transmission. KIA dealer says I need a remanufactured transmission @ $3300. The part has to be ordered and there is a significant delay in getting it, plus I have to prepay. I have 141000 miles on it and planned to keep it a while longer, but I am having doubts about that now. I noticed there was a recall on the books for my year and model concerning the noise coming from the transmission. I am going to see if that will apply to my car. If not, I am going to trade it for a 2005 Lexus LX470 I have my eye on.

Kia Sorento - junk yard

I have a 2011 KIA Sorento, with less than 60,00 miles. The power Smart key module and ECM. Stoped working. One night it was fine. Next morning the car was dead….. Less than 60,000miles. Down now for 8 months…… All Kia says is they can’t get the parts….. That I can sale it to a junk yard.

Has made sure I'll never buy Kia again.

Where to begin... first few years were good. The last few, not so good though. Door locks, windows and cruise control work when they want. Backup camera does the same. Been that way for years. Oil leaking somewhere on the motor, mechanic has no clue. You know you have a bad model when you overhear the mechanics at the dealership complaining about how many they have worked on and how crappy of a vehicle it is.
